(formally titled Guideline for Structural Condition Assessment of Existing Buildings ) is an update to the earlier ASCE 11-90 standard. It provides a structured methodology for assessing the structural conditions of existing buildings. Key Purposes of ASCE 11-99
ASCE 11-99 provides a rigorous, standardized methodology for assessing the structural condition of existing buildings. Originally published in 1999 and reaffirmed periodically, this guideline helps engineers determine whether a building can safely continue its current use, withstand a change in occupancy, or undergo significant renovations.
It's important to know that the 1999 edition (11-99) is not the most current version of this guideline. In 2024, ASCE released an updated adaptation titled . The 2024 publication functions as a newly designed adaptation of the original 11-99. It retains all of the original standard’s technical depth but is repackaged for easier use and improved accessibility.
